A classic decent from the summit of the Tzoo. Several steep rocky downs with some ride around possibilities and some technical short climb sections. Great views over Cowichan Bay. Not the trail to take as an low/intermediate rider. Advanced riders will love it. Drop that post Intersects with the Cross Trail. Go right at the bottom to access Danylizer to head to the Kaspa parking or Chicken Run to continue the ride for another loop.
